Employee Dining Room Cook - Casino jobs in Chillicothe, OH

Employee Dining Room Cook - Casino prepares food to be served in the employee dining room. Cooks meals based on established recipes and employee requests. Being an Employee Dining Room Cook - Casino ensures meal quality and employee satisfaction. May require a high school diploma or its equivalent. Additionally, Employee Dining Room Cook - Casino typically reports to a supervisor. The Employee Dining Room Cook - Casino may require 0-1 year of general work experience. Possesses a moderate understanding of general aspects of the job. Works under the close direction of senior personnel in the functional area.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Chillicothe (/ˌtʃɪlɪˈkɒθi/ CHIL-i-KOTH-ee) is a city in and the county seat of Ross County, Ohio, United States. Located along the Scioto River 45 miles south of Columbus, Chillicothe was the first and third capital of Ohio. It is the only city in Ross County and the center of the Chillicothe Micropolitan Statistical Area (as defined by the United States Census Bureau in 2003). The population was 21,901 at the 2010 census. Chillicothe is a designated Tree City USA by the National Arbor Day Foundation.
